What I would really like to do is check if there is an up-to-date cache file at the TOP of my script. If there is, print it and stop there. Otherwise go through and run all the sql queries and take a bunch of time. Is there a good way for me to not run all my code for no reason every time I print a cached page? Thanks.

The information you want is in the manual -- look up the is_cached function Smile
